# Quillbase Environments — N+1 fix rollout

Heads up for release planning: the resolver batching fix for the N+1 mess in Quillbase's GraphQL layer is live in dev and staging, and it's a big deal — list queries dropped from ~400 DB calls to about 6. Prod is gated behind a flag so we can roll back without a redeploy. Staging has been soaking for a week with no regressions. Each environment currently runs with the values below.

settings of fafog-haduf:
ZORIX_PIN=4648
ZORIX_METRICS_HOST=metrics.zorix.paliqsys.corp
ZORIX_LOG_LEVEL=info
ZORIX_TENANT=druix

Facilities ticket — Night shift, Brindlecote Campus. Twenty-two interns from the Fennhollow programme arrive tomorrow at 08:00. Please unlock seminar rooms B2 and B3 by 06:30, set chairs to classroom layout, and confirm the water coolers on level one are refilled. Leave the loading bay clear for their equipment van. Overnight access to the prep corridor requires the pass code below.

badge for bajop-yawep: bdg-NNHEW-6

Subject: Ledgerline build moving to hermetic toolchain tonight

Release folks,

Ledgerline's nightly switches to the Glasskiln hermetic build system at 02:00. No network fetches, pinned toolchain, reproducible outputs. On-call: if the nightly fails, do not fall back to the legacy builder — page the build crew instead. Rollback artifacts stay available for 72 hours. Verification token for the first hermetic build follows.

build token for kagaf-hahof: htk14_9d3d4d26d7d8de

Runbook: account recovery for TilePlow, the map-tile prefetcher. If the service account locks after three failed token rotations, stop the prefetch daemon on the Harker cluster first. Clear the stale lease in the coordinator. Re-enroll via the ops console using the recovery flow — not a new account. Verify tile queues drain before re-enabling scheduling. Flag any anomalies in the sync notes. The recovery flow will prompt for the passphrase, which appears on the next line.

vault phrase of kawep-tahog = ulaix-briath

Canary gating for Ferrowatch: promotion proceeds only if error rate stays under 0.5% and p95 latency under 300ms for 15 minutes. Overrides require two approvers in the gating console. The gate evaluator authenticates to the metrics store with a dedicated token, which must be present in the evaluator's .env file on the line that follows.

vault entry, yajop-bafop: ARCHIVE_KEY3=8d4